A county jail typically holds individuals who are awaiting trial, serving short sentences, or detained for probation or parole violations. These facilities are managed at the local level, often by a sheriffβs department, and operate under state and federal regulations that define standards for security, health care, and programming. Unlike prisons run by state or federal systems, county jails often focus on short term stays, although populations can vary based on arrest patterns, court schedules, and local policies. Understanding this distinction helps clarify why experiences inside one county facility may differ from another.
Daily routines inside such a facility usually follow structured schedules designed to balance security, movement, and available services. Inmates may have set times for meals, recreation, cell checks, and access to telephones or visitation, depending on classification and housing unit. Health care, education opportunities, and work assignments also depend on local resources and protocols. What does a typical day look like inside the facility?
A typical day often starts early, with wake up times, head counts, and structured blocks for meals, recreation, and programming. Inmates may have access to educational classes, job training, or counseling when those services are available, though schedules can change based on staffing, security levels, and facility priorities. Movement is usually limited to designated areas, and personal time in cells may be required when not engaged in approved activities. Understanding this routine helps set realistic expectations about daily life behind bars.
How can visitation and communication work for families?
Visitation policies typically include set hours, security procedures such as screening and sign in, and limits on contact during meetings. Many facilities now offer scheduled appointments either in person or through video visitation systems, depending on local technology investments and public health considerations. Phone calls and written correspondence are generally available, though these services may involve fees or restrictions. Families often rely on official websites or direct communication with jail staff to learn current rules and schedules.

Things People Often Misunderstand
A common misconception is that all county jails operate the same way, when in reality policies on education, medical care, and security can differ significantly based on location, budget, and leadership priorities. Another misunderstanding involves rehabilitation, with some people assuming that facilities focus only on punishment, while many programs aim to reduce recidivism through job training, substance use support, and cognitive behavioral interventions. Clarifying these points helps readers separate generalizations from the nuanced reality of daily operations.
